The EU’s High Representative, Josep Borrell, and Mark Leonard discussed why strategic autonomy matters, looking at ECFR’s major contribution to the debate – Sovereign Europe, dangerous world: Five agendas to protect Europe’s capacity to act – as well as the three regions where Europe’s strategic interests are most at stake: Asia, the Eastern Neighbourhood, and the Southern Neighbourhood.
Together, they explored how 2021 will mark a new phase for the EU and its members, while demonstrating how Europe can be an effective partner for the new Biden administration.
